I can take it when Pools get beat I'm a realist, we are going to lose games what I won't accept as a Pools fan is us losing like we did last night. I can't remember the last time I watched Pools lose like that we got fooking tortured it should/could have 7 or 8 in the second half alone we didn't even compete with Doncaster. The most worrying aspect of the whole evening was that it was so glaringly obvious were the problems originated all night our left hand side. Coppinger had the better of Humphreys all night and the full back was also a decent player who overlapped at will. Humphreys got tortured throughout the night but then again he was literally having to mark two players all of the time he must have hated every minute of that game. He had no protection at all from Foley who is simply too small to play against a team like Donny, couldn't Wilson see this? He is paying Elliott a hefty wage and whatever people think of the lad to leave him on the bench last night was absurd. Was he expecting a call from his US estate agent!? They were a good side who exploited the weakness to the full but it hardly took a graduate in quantum physics to work it out.

I also felt sorry for our other 'full back' Sweeney who was picked to try and win headers against a centre forward playing wide left in McCammon. Sweeney emerged from the game with immense credit offer that lad a decent contract because his attitude is spot on we don't want to lose people like him. It is laughable that we now have our best attacking box to box midfielder playing right back when Micky Barron the only talker capable of organising the back four has been ignored all season.
